Conservation Organisations in Cambridge > Traffic International

Traffic International

Phone View phone number 219a Huntingdon Road,
CAMBRIDGE,
CB3 0DL
view on map
Get directions
Look for more Conservation Organisations in Cambridge

Traffic International

Other Conservation Organisations near CB3 0DL

Review Us





I want to use my Facebook profile
I am a registered user
I am a new user